6 Red Pill Opportunity ... Please Enquire Within... posted 2 years ago by VaccinesCauseSIDS 2 years ago by VaccinesCauseSIDS +7 / -1 5 comments share 5 comments share save hide report block hide replies
Aulis.com is hands down the biggest red pill ever on the moon landing hoax. If you want a deep dive this is the site Frens.
Second this, anon.
I thought i was the only one who had that bookmarked.. I read over that a few times and was like "wow, ok, i have to change my beliefs to 'i can't say for sure'".